Output 7d3995e4baeca009c9771143c7828e54d060ec831ac6983740773f8085b71b3c:9

value
486100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bbdabc3d4240f9c45e27a9c987e3e9e35c3b95f OP_EQUAL
address
3FtVsr4Ayv5SpSSFCoUAF97o6d1HUnXt5e
transaction
7d3995e4baeca009c9771143c7828e54d060ec831ac6983740773f8085b71b3c
confirmations
284470
spent
true